出 处:《桥梁建设》2014年第6期29-34,共6页Bridge Construction
摘 要:武汉军山长江大桥为主跨460m双塔双索面钢箱梁斜拉桥,2011年安装了健康监测系统。该桥通行多为重车,并时有超载现象出现。为了解重车过桥结构性能,评判重载对结构的影响程度,基于该桥上安装的健康监测系统,对2辆载重178t的重车先后通过该桥的主梁位移、桥塔偏位、主梁应力、索力进行了全程采集,并与有限元计算值、阈值进行对比分析。分析结果表明:桥梁空载状态和卸载状态下桥塔残余变形以及主梁残余变形和残余应力均较小,卸载后斜拉索振动幅值恢复正常,结构处于弹性状态,性能良好;重车过桥结构响应均在活载计算包络曲线内,重载对结构的影响很小,结构无损伤发生;结构响应实测值与计算值吻合较好。Wuhan Junshan Changjiang River with double pylons, double cable planes and with Bridge is a steel box girder cable-stayed bridge a main of 460 m and in 2011, the health monito- ring system was installed on the bridge. The vehicles passing the bridge are mostly the heavy ve- hicles and from time to time, the overload vehicles may appear on the bridge. To understand the structural performance of the bridge under passage of the heavy vehicles and to judge the degrees of influence of the heavy load on the structure, the whole process data of the main girder displace- ment, pylon offsetting, main girder stress and the stay cable forces of the bridge at the time 2 sets of the 178 t heavy vehicles passed the bridge in succession were acquired based on the health monitoring system and the data were analyzed and compared to the finite element calculation val+ ues and the threshold values. The results of the analysis suggest that the residual deformation of the pylons and the residual deformation and residual stress of the main girder of the bridge in the state of empty load and unloading are little. After the bridge is unloaded, the vibration amplitude values of the stay cables return to normal, the structure is in the elastic state and the structural performance is good. The structural responses of the bridge under passage of the heavy vehicles are within the range of the live load calculation envelope curves, the influence of the heavy load on the bridge is little, the structure has no damage and the measured values of the structural re- sponses are well agreeable with the calculated ones.
